General Maintenance & Equipment Technician
Level: Hands-on generalist — no formal certificate or trade required
Alternate titles: Maintenance Mechanic / Facility & Equipment Technician / Maintenance Generalist
Purpose
A capable, mechanically inclined “do-it-all” maintenance person who keeps equipment, facilities, and systems running across the operation. The right person is a practical problem-solver who can turn their hand to a wide range of repairs and upkeep — no formal trade ticket required, just solid mechanical ability, common sense, and a willingness to take on whatever needs fixing.
Key Responsibilities
- General equipment maintenance and repair, including pump replacement and servicing.
- Routine servicing of mobile equipment — e.g. changing oil and basic upkeep on skid steers and similar machinery.
- Basic electrical work, including replacing and repairing light fixtures and general electrical maintenance.
- Welding and basic metal fabrication/repair as needed around the facility and equipment.
- Basic plumbing repairs — fixing leaks, replacing fittings, and general water-line upkeep.
- General facility maintenance and handyman tasks to keep sites safe, functional, and tidy.
- Respond to breakdowns and maintenance needs promptly to minimize equipment downtime.
- Identify recurring issues and suggest practical fixes or improvements.
- Work safely and follow site safety practices at all times.
What We're Looking For
- Strong overall mechanical aptitude — a person who is naturally good with their hands and equipment.
- Working knowledge across several areas: pumps, small-engine/equipment servicing, basic electrical, welding, and basic plumbing.
- No formal certificate or trade ticket required; relevant hands-on experience matters more than credentials.
- Resourceful and self-directed — able to diagnose a problem and get it fixed without much oversight.
- Reliable, safety-minded, and comfortable switching between different types of work in a day.
- Shift flexible — willing and able to work a flexible schedule, including coverage outside standard hours as needs require.
Nice to Have
- Experience in an industrial, plant, or shop environment.
- Comfort operating mobile equipment (skid steer, forklift, etc.).
- Any welding, electrical, or mechanical experience that broadens the range of jobs they can take on.
Position Details
Reports to
Site Manager / designate
Schedule
Shift flexible — flexible hours including coverage outside standard hours as required
Certificates
None required — mechanical ability and hands-on experience valued over formal trades
Success measures
Equipment uptime; speed and quality of repairs; range of work handled in-house vs. contracted out; safety record.
